Abstract

A prismatic battery cell (6) includes: a box-shaped metal casing (9), further comprising a first bottom wall (11) and a second bottom wall (12) opposite to each other along one of the longitudinal axes (L) of the cell; a stack (10) including a plurality of electrode plates (19) alternating with each other and spaced apart by a plurality of insulating foils; wherein the electrode plates (19) are alternately a plurality of anode plates (20) and a plurality of cathode plates (21), respectively longitudinally along the longitudinal axis (L) and along the longitudinal axis (L). A transverse axis (T) extends laterally; wherein the anode plates (20) protrude a plurality of first metal terminal elements (22) toward the first bottom wall (11) along the longitudinal axis (L); the cathode plates (21) protrude a plurality of second metal terminal elements (23) toward the second bottom wall (12) along the longitudinal axis (L) in the opposite direction to the first metal terminal elements (22); the second metal terminal elements (23) extend across the entire width of the cathode plates (21).
